Acetamide and ethylamine can be distinguished ,by reacting with

  • Br2 water

  • acidic KMnO4

  • aq HCl and heat

  • aq NaOH and heat


D.

aq NaOH and heat

Acetamide and Ethylamine can be distinguished by using aq NaOH followed by heating. Acetamide gives sodium acetate with NaOH whereas ethylamine does not react with NaOH.
